Regards, Dumitru > On 1/24/25 14:24, Mark Michelson wrote: >> Using the ACL IDs created in the previous commit, northd adds this ID to >> the conntrack entry for persist-established ACLs. >> >> ovn-controller keeps track of the southbound ACL IDs. If an ACL ID is >> removed from the southbound database, then ovn-controller flushes the >> conntrack entry whose label contains the deleted ACL ID. >> >> With this change, it means that deleting an allow-established ACL, or >> changing its action type to something else, will result in the conntrack >> entry being flushed. This will cause the traffic to no longer >> automatically be allowed. >> >> Reported-at: https://issues.redhat.com/browse/FDP-815 >> Signed-off-by: Mark Michelson <[email protected]> >> --- >> v6 -> v7: >> * Rebased. >> * Fixed an overzealous search and replace in ovn-north.at that caused a >> test to fail. >> >> v5 -> v6: >> * Moved REG_ACL_ID to reg2[16..31] so that it does not conflict with >> other registers.
